Osteoclasts are the cells responsible for breaking down bone tissue in a process known as bone resorption. They secrete acid and enzymes that degrade the bone matrix, allowing for the remodelling and repair of bones.

The three types of tissue in bone are compact bone, spongy bone, and bone marrow. Compact bone makes up the dense outer layer of bones, spongy bone forms the inner layer, and bone marrow, found within the bone cavities, is responsible for blood cell production.
Yes, both cartilage and bone are living tissues. They contain cells, such as chondrocytes in cartilage and osteocytes in bone, that help maintain the structure and function of these tissues. Blood vessels also supply nutrients and oxygen to these tissues, allowing them to grow, repair, and remodel.
There are different forms of mesenchymal cells and tissues found almost everywhere in the body, and these tissues can be thought of, broadly, as: connective tissues, blood vessels, and lymphatic vessels.Mesenchymal cells/ tissues originate from the middle embryonic germ layer (there are 3 - endoderm, mesoderm, ectoderm) called the "mesoderm" and differentiate into the body's various connective tissues found in bone, cartilage, ligaments, tendons, muscles, skin, organs, extracellular matrix, as they also form the blood vessels and lymphatic vessels.

The primary cell type in connective tissue proper in cartilage is the chondrocyte, which is responsible for maintaining the cartilage matrix. In bone, the primary cell type is the osteocyte, which helps maintain bone tissue and communicates with other bone cells. Both cell types are crucial for the health and functionality of their respective tissues.

The tissues that regenerate well in the body include the skin, liver, bone marrow, and the inner lining of the intestine. These tissues have a high capacity for cell proliferation and replacement, allowing them to heal and regenerate after injury or damage.
